A fractal surface was generated on computer by random addition method. The simulated measurement on this surface shows that z resolution has little effect on calculating fractal dimension D while the lower x y resolution causes larger statistic error. D was calculated for Au films on three kind of substfate using data from Scanning Tunneling Microscope(STM) images. D = 2. 15 for Au/ceramic, and D = 2. 06 for Au/optical glass. D has different values for different points on Au/general glass, the reason of mismatch between curves from STM images of different scan sizes was also discussed.
